Coach Hobby stopped by to visit with Clemson verbal commitment Ronald Geohaghan on Wednesday.
“Coach Hobby came by today. He came to the school and to the house. It was a good visit. We talked about signing day and what I need to do. He told me to be prepared before I come up this summer,” said Geohaghan.
During his official visit earlier this month Ronald and the other defensive backs picked up the nickname “the four horsemen”. How does the All-American feel about the nickname?
“Yeah I like it. It is cool,” replied Geohaghan.
Signing day will be a little different for Ronald as he visits Texas.
“I am going to Austin, Texas for the USA verse the World game. I will be out there for signing day so I will have to sign it out there,” said Geohaghan.
The Shrine Bowl standout looks forward to playing for his country.
“We leave on Friday. My dad is coming out there with me. I am excited about the opportunity,” said Geohaghan.
The future Clemson defensive back can’t wait to sign with the Tigers next week.
“I am really excited. It will kind of make it official. I am ready to put it behind me,” said Geohaghan.
What are Ronald’s plans for the next few months as he prepares to enroll at Clemson this summer?
“I am going to work hard in the books and the weight room. I want to prepare myself so that hopefully I am able to play as a true freshman,” said Geohaghan.
